Signs You Need Water Heater Service

Your water heater often provides warning signs before a complete breakdown. Recognizing these indicators early can prevent larger, more inconvenient issues. If you notice any of the following in your San Dimas home, it's likely time to consider professional water heater service:

  1. No Hot Water or Insufficient Hot Water: This is the most obvious sign. It could indicate a faulty heating element (electric), a pilot light issue or gas supply problem (gas), or a thermostat malfunction.
  2. Strange Noises: Gurgling, popping, or rumbling sounds often signal sediment buildup in the tank. As the sediment heats, trapped water boils, creating these noises. Sediment reduces efficiency and can damage the tank.
  3. Leaking: Puddles around the base of the water heater are a clear problem. Leaks can originate from various points, including connections, the temperature and pressure relief (T&P) valve, or cracks in the tank itself. Tank leaks usually mean the unit needs replacement.
  4. Smelly or Discolored Water: Rusty or reddish water can indicate corrosion inside the tank or pipes. Water with a rotten-egg smell is typically caused by bacteria reacting with the anode rod in the tank.
  5. Low Hot Water Pressure: If hot water pressure is significantly lower than cold water pressure, it could be due to mineral or sediment buildup restricting flow within the heater or pipes.
  6. Pilot Light Issues (Gas Heaters): If the pilot light frequently goes out, or won't stay lit, it could point to a problem with the thermocouple, gas supply, or the pilot assembly itself.

Ignoring these signs can lead to decreased efficiency, higher energy bills, and potentially costly damage to your home from leaks.

Water Heater Replacement & Installation

Sometimes, repair is not the most cost-effective or long-term solution. Knowing when to replace your water heater is important for efficiency and reliability.

When to Consider Water Heater Replacement:

  1. Age: A standard tank water heater typically lasts 10–15 years. If yours is approaching or past this age, replacement is often more economical than repeated repairs. Tankless units generally have a longer lifespan, often 20 years or more.
  2. Frequent Breakdowns: If your water heater requires frequent repairs, the cumulative cost can quickly outweigh the investment in a new, more reliable unit.
  3. Major Leaks: A leak from the tank itself usually indicates internal corrosion or failure and requires immediate replacement.
  4. Inefficiency: Older units become less efficient over time, leading to higher energy bills. If your bills are increasing without a change in usage, an aging water heater could be the culprit.
  5. Rust-Colored Water: As mentioned, this can indicate significant internal corrosion, suggesting the tank's integrity is compromised.

Tank vs. Tankless Water Heaters: Choosing the Right One

One of the biggest decisions for homeowners needing a new water heater is choosing between a traditional storage tank unit and a tankless (on-demand) system. Both have distinct advantages:

Standard Tank Water Heaters:

  1. How they work: Store and pre-heat a large volume of water in a tank.
  2. Initial Cost: Generally lower upfront cost.
  3. Installation: Simpler and often less expensive installation than tankless.
  4. Capacity: Provides a limited supply of hot water based on tank size. Can run out during high demand.
  5. Energy Efficiency: Less efficient than tankless because they continuously heat water, even when not in use (standby heat loss).
  6. Lifespan: Typically 10–15 years.

Tankless Water Heaters:

  1. How they work: Heat water on demand only when a hot water tap is opened.
  2. Initial Cost: Higher upfront purchase and installation cost.
  3. Installation: More complex installation may require gas line upgrades or new venting (for gas) or significant electrical work (for electric).
  4. Capacity: Provides a continuous supply of hot water, theoretically endless as long as flow rate is within the unit's capacity.
  5. Energy Efficiency: Highly energy efficient as they only use energy when hot water is needed. Can save significantly on energy bills over time.
  6. Lifespan: Typically 20 years or more.
  7. Size: Much smaller and can be mounted on a wall, saving space.

Water Heater Maintenance: Essential Care

Regular maintenance is vital for maximizing the lifespan, efficiency, and performance of your water heater. Over time, sediment (minerals like calcium and magnesium) can build up at the bottom of tank-style heaters, especially in areas with hard water like San Dimas.

Why is maintenance important?

  1. Prevents Sediment Buildup: Sediment reduces heating efficiency, increases energy consumption, makes noise, and can corrode the tank.
  2. Extends Lifespan: Regular flushing and inspection can identify potential issues early and prevent premature failure.
  3. Maintains Efficiency: A clean and well-maintained unit operates more efficiently, saving you money on energy bills.
  4. Ensures Safety: Checking the T&P valve and other components ensures the unit operates safely.
  5. Validates Warranty: Many manufacturers require proof of annual maintenance to uphold the warranty.

A key part of maintenance for tank units is flushing the tank. This involves draining the tank to remove accumulated sediment. For tankless units, maintenance often involves flushing heat exchangers to remove mineral buildup that can impede flow and heating efficiency.

Understanding Water Heater Service Costs

The cost of water heater service varies depending on the specific issue, the type of water heater you have (tank or tankless, gas or electric), the age and condition of the unit, and the complexity of the repair or installation. Simple repairs like replacing a heating element or thermostat are typically less expensive than resolving a major leak or replacing the entire unit. Tankless water heater repairs or installations can sometimes have higher labor costs due to their complexity.

Replacement costs are influenced by the type and size of the new unit, as well as any necessary plumbing, gas line, or electrical modifications required for installation.
